Do the restrictions on a Bevaris Alliance franchisee apply if they are acting on behalf of another entity?

Bevaris_Alliance Franchise · 2024 FDD

Answer from 2024 FDD Document

  • 20.3 The restrictions imposed on the Franchisee and the Individual by this clause 20 apply to them acting:
    • (a) directly or indirectly; and
    • (b) on their own behalf or on behalf of, or in conjunction with, any firm, company or person.

Source: Item 23 — RECEIPT (FDD pages 22–88)

What This Means (2024 FDD)

According to the 2024 Bevaris Alliance Franchise Disclosure Document, the restrictions imposed on franchisees apply whether they are acting directly or indirectly. These restrictions also apply whether the franchisee is acting on their own behalf, on behalf of, or in conjunction with any firm, company, or person. This means that a franchisee cannot circumvent the restrictions outlined in the franchise agreement by operating through another entity or in partnership with another party.

This provision ensures that Bevaris Alliance franchisees are held accountable for adhering to the franchise agreement, regardless of the structure they use to conduct business. It prevents franchisees from using a separate business or partnership to engage in activities that would otherwise be prohibited under the agreement. This is a common clause in franchise agreements designed to protect the franchisor's brand and business model.

For a prospective Bevaris Alliance franchisee, this means they must fully understand and comply with all restrictions, even if they operate through a company or with partners. Failure to comply with these restrictions, whether acting directly or indirectly, could result in a breach of the franchise agreement and potential legal consequences.
